Upcoming Fixtures

Manchester United has an exciting schedule in the coming weeks that includes both domestic league matches and crucial cup competitions. They are set to face their arch-rivals Liverpool at Old Trafford next Sunday, 15th October, a match that is always highly anticipated by supporters from both sides. Following this, United will compete in the UEFA Champions League against Borussia Dortmund on Tuesday, 18th October. This match is significant as it will determine their chances of progressing to the knockout stages of the tournament.

Additionally, United’s fixtures also include a home match against Tottenham Hotspur on 23rd October in the Premier League, a game that will test the resilience and tactics of Erik ten Hag’s team, who are vying for a Champions League spot next season.

Recent Performance

In their last five matches, Manchester United has shown a mixed bag of results, with two wins, two losses, and one draw. Notably, their most recent loss to Arsenal raised concerns over their defensive frailties, which they will need to address to achieve success in their upcoming fixtures. The manager has called for an improved performance from his players against strong opponents and emphasised the importance of consistency.
